The Peru oscilloscope market is experiencing steady growth driven by increasing demand from sectors such as electronics, telecommunications, automotive, and healthcare. The market is primarily fueled by technological advancements leading to the development of more sophisticated oscilloscope models with higher bandwidth and faster sampling rates. Key players in the Peru market include Tektronix, Keysight Technologies, and Rigol Technologies. The rising adoption of oscilloscopes in research and development activities, quality control processes, and troubleshooting applications is further boosting the market growth. Additionally, the increasing focus on automation and digitization across industries is driving the demand for oscilloscopes in Peru. The market is expected to continue its growth trajectory as industries increasingly rely on oscilloscopes for accurate signal analysis and measurement applications.
The Peru oscilloscope market is witnessing several key trends. One major trend is the increasing demand for digital oscilloscopes over traditional analog models due to their higher accuracy and advanced features. Additionally, there is a growing focus on compact and portable oscilloscope models to cater to the needs of technicians and engineers working in field applications. Another notable trend is the integration of oscilloscopes with advanced technologies such as IoT and cloud connectivity, allowing for remote monitoring and analysis. Furthermore, there is a rising adoption of oscilloscopes in various industries such as electronics, automotive, and telecommunications for tasks such as signal analysis, troubleshooting, and quality control. Overall, the Peru oscilloscope market is evolving towards more innovative, user-friendly, and technologically advanced solutions to meet the increasing demands of the industry.
In the Peru Oscilloscope Market, several challenges are encountered, including intense competition from both domestic and international players leading to price wars and pressure on profit margins. Additionally, the market faces issues related to the availability of skilled technical professionals who can effectively operate and maintain advanced oscilloscope technologies. Limited awareness and understanding of the benefits of oscilloscopes among end-users also pose a challenge in driving market growth. Furthermore, economic instability and fluctuations in currency exchange rates can impact the affordability of oscilloscopes for potential buyers, further hindering market expansion. Overall, addressing these challenges will require strategic marketing efforts, investment in training programs, and the development of cost-effective solutions tailored to the needs of the Peru Oscilloscope Market.

In Peru, the government has implemented policies to regulate the oscilloscope market, focusing primarily on ensuring product quality and consumer safety. The National Institute for the Defense of Competition and Protection of Intellectual Property (INDECOPI) is responsible for overseeing compliance with technical standards and certifications for oscilloscopes sold in the country. Additionally, import regulations require that oscilloscopes meet specific technical requirements to enter the Peruvian market, further ensuring product quality and reliability. These policies aim to safeguard consumers from substandard products and promote fair competition among manufacturers and distributors in the oscilloscope market in Peru.
